Myrna Gower B.A., M.A. CQSW. Qual. in F.T. (Tavistock)Myrna is a systemic psychotherapist and organisational consultant. She has spent her career operating in both the public and private mental health sectors including corporate and professional environments.  Myrna has been teaching at post-graduate level since the early 80s at Royal Holloway, University of London, The Tavistock Clinic and St George’s Hospital.  She has just completed a 3 year term of office chairing The Association for Family Therapy(AFT)  Accreditation Group, accrediting systemic training programmes throughout the UK. She continues her work with the AFT accreditation of clinicians and is involved with ongoing psychological research.

Myrna acts as a consultant to individuals and teams within businesses, specialising in communication in the work place. She is particularly interested in the psychological contribution to strategising negotiations with clients towards successful deal closure.

Myrna joined Bright Side Productions in 1999 to work with Georgina on leadership, coaching and client relationship management initiatives for professional practices and in the corporate sector.   Together they combine their commercial and psychological skills to help clients to become more profitable, whilst living profitable lives.   

This summer (2011), Myrna was awarded a Doctorate for her research on parenting adult children.
